“At the moment” present host Savannah Guthrie and her siblings launched a brand new video on Saturday saying they’ve obtained a message and begged for the return of their missing mother, saying, “We can pay.”
“We obtained your message and we perceive,” Guthrie mentioned within the transient video posted to Instagram. “We beg you now to return our mom to us so we are able to rejoice together with her. That is the one method we may have peace. That is very helpful to us, and we can pay.”
Nancy Guthrie, 84, was final seen Jan. 31, and authorities have mentioned they consider she was kidnapped from her residence.

“We’re conscious of the video posted by the Guthrie household. However have no further info to share,” a spokesperson for Pima Sheriff mentioned in a press release to ABC Information on Saturday following the discharge of the most recent video from the household.
The message Savannah Guthrie references in her new Instagram put up is similar message the FBI and Pima Sheriff said they were studying Friday, in accordance a supply aware of the investigation.
Investigators nonetheless haven’t confirmed the authenticity of the most recent message which was obtained by a Tucson tv station, nor any of the opposite ransom notes mentioning Nancy Guthrie, in keeping with a supply aware of the investigation.

Nevertheless, investigators proceed to take the entire messages critically.
There aren’t any new leads that developed Saturday, the supply mentioned, echoing an earlier assertion from the Pima County Sheriff’s Division
The FBI is providing a $50,000 reward for info that might result in the restoration of Nancy Guthrie and/or an arrest and conviction in her abduction.
Nancy Guthrie was dropped off at residence shortly after 10 p.m. on Jan. 31, after having dinner together with her household. She was reported lacking the subsequent morning after she didn’t present as much as church, in keeping with authorities.

A doorbell digicam at her residence within the Catalina Foothills space north of Tucson, Arizona, was disconnected at about 1:45 a.m. Sunday morning. Shortly earlier than 2:30 a.m. her pacemaker app indicated it was disconnected from her telephone, in keeping with authorities.

Her blood was additionally discovered on the porch of her residence, in keeping with the sheriff.
Investigators haven’t recognized a suspect or individual of curiosity within the case, Pima County Sheriff Chris Nanos mentioned throughout a press briefing on Thursday.
Ransom notes have been despatched to a number of native and nationwide media retailers and they’re being taken critically, in keeping with the FBI.
Previous to the video on Saturday, Savannah Guthrie and her siblings have posted different movies urging their mom’s suspected kidnappers to make contact with them and supply proof she continues to be alive.
